🧑‍🍳In the kitchen, sunflower seeds are incredibly versatile. They can be enjoyed as a crunchy snack on their own, sprinkled over salads for added texture, or incorporated into granola for a nutritious breakfast option. When baking, consider adding them to breads or muffins to introduce a delightful nuttiness. Toasting the seeds lightly before use can enhance their flavor, bringing out their natural sweetness and making them even more satisfying.
